#0d6282 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d6282 is composed of 5.1% red, 38.4%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 196.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 28%. #0d6282 color hex could be obtained by blending #1ac4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

● #0d6282 color description : Dark blue.
#0d6282 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d6282 has RGB values of R:13, G:98,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 877186.
